It would be nice to have real grass, much better looking but is it even feasible without enough sunlight? The turf isn't even that bad. Its not like the old astro turf that was super thin. I've played a few baseball games on the turf at the Rogers Centre while I worked with them over the All star break. It actually has great cushion and bounce to it. It feels like fake grass combined with something similar to the recycled rubber tires used in some playgrounds. If they were to do that does that mean they can't hold concerts or other events there either?

What they really need to change is the in game experience like many posters have pointed out. The food with the exception of the 100 level and club VIP is terrible. Windows restaurant remains empty. Too much exposed concrete and the seats suck except for the padding in the 200 level and VIP seats. They should invest in the stadium as well because it is terrible compared to going to the ACC.
